Transaction 43943cc1b31e210a54cbbae1c78146cf5707691952a6baa31cd80e2892f6962e
1 Input
1 Output
-
43943cc1b31e210a54cbbae1c78146cf5707691952a6baa31cd80e2892f6962e:0
- value
- 51458
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0e1207d92981eb6fe217281bd840cb04aa67d046638544c57c53b2a49fe53d74
- address
- bc1ppcfq0kffs84klcsh9qdassxtqj4x05zxvwz5f3tu2we2f8l9846qe2svvz